The uncomfortable feeling that can come when you feel out of control can feel really horrible.
People can feel out of control for a whole host of different reasons, from being in situations where they feel out of control (such as a fear of flying, a fear of spiders or a fear of heights), or where they are out of control of their own body or emotions (such as blushing, stuttering, shy bladder).
Sometimes people feel out of control because they’ve got something about themselves that they feel powerless to change, for example if they’re doing something that they’d rather not be doing (like overeating or smoking), or if they don’t feel able to do something that they’d like to do (like presentations of public speaking).
